Deck and patio contractors build new outdoor living spaces and replace aging structures using wood, composite decking, pavers, stamped concrete, and natural stone. Pressure-treated lumber is the most affordable decking material, while composite (Trex, TimberTech) offers low maintenance and longer warranties at a higher upfront cost. Decks attached to a house require a building permit and must meet code for ledger board attachment, joist spacing, railing height, and stair dimensions — improperly attached decks are a serious safety hazard. Patios are typically ground-level and may not require permits, but proper base preparation and drainage are critical for longevity.
What to look for when hiring a decks & patios contractor
- ✓Confirm the estimate specifies the decking material, framing lumber, and fastener system.
- ✓Ask about their approach to ledger board attachment and flashing — the #1 point of deck failure.
- ✓Verify they pull the required building permit for any attached or elevated deck.
- ✓Ask about the warranty on both materials and workmanship.

Pressure-treated wood deck: $15–$25/sq ft. Composite deck: $25–$50/sq ft. Paver patio: $12–$25/sq ft. A typical 300 sq ft deck runs $4,500–$15,000.

How do I find a reliable decks & patios contractor in Sunrise?
Start by verifying the contractor holds a valid Florida license. Check their Google rating and read reviews. Get at least three written estimates. Confirm they carry general liability and workers' compensation insurance. Ask for references from recent Sunrise jobs.
